K9 teams are not a replacement for licensed event security guards — they are a specialized augmentation. A certified explosive-detection K9 sweeps a venue 100× faster than human inspectors with handheld equipment. A patrol K9 covers a large construction site faster than two human guards alone. The visible presence of a working K9 at a nightclub door reduces drug-bringing-in attempts by 30–50% per industry studies.
| Configuration | Hourly rate |
|---|---|
| Single handler + patrol K9 | $90–$180/hour |
| EDD certified team (event sweep) | $200–$350/hour |
| NDD team (nightclub deterrent) | $100–$160/hour |
| VIP protection K9 (24-hour detail) | $1,500–$3,500/day |
| Multi-team festival deployment | $3,000–$8,000/day for 3–6 teams |
K9 handlers must hold the provincial security guard licence (PSISA Ontario, BSP Quebec, etc.) plus team-specific K9 certification. Provincial animal welfare statutes apply to working dogs. Insurance must include a dog-bite liability rider with minimum $2 million coverage; most major venues require $5 million when K9 teams are deployed inside ticketed perimeters.
In Quebec, multiple security firms specialize in maître-chien services with bilingual handlers — the Montreal festival and concert circuit (Osheaga, Just for Laughs, Igloofest) routinely deploys EDD and NDD teams. Bilingual handlers are essential for crowd communication during evacuations or controlled-access incidents at francophone events, and several firms maintain dedicated EDD teams certified to NCB, CCNCC, or CKC working dog standards.
Choose a K9 deployment when speed of detection matters (pre-event sweeps under 60 minutes for venues over 5,000 seats), when visible deterrence is the goal (nightclub doors, festival entrances), or when the deployment area exceeds what 2–3 human guards can patrol effectively. For pure access control or crowd flow, conventional event security guards remain the cost-effective choice.
